§ 3019-a. Notice of termination of service by teachers. A teacher who\ndesires to terminate his services to a school district at any time,\nshall file a written notice thereof with the school authorities of such\nschool district or with the board of cooperative educational services or\ncounty vocational education and extension board at least thirty days\nprior to the date of such termination of services. School authorities\nor such boards which desire to terminate the services of a teacher\nduring the probationary period shall give a written notice thereof to\nsuch teacher at least thirty days prior to the effective date of such\ntermination of services.\n
